X Posted August 28, 2005 Posted August 28, 2005 If you skip X you should be able to get on The B&Ms, Goliath and DejaVu if you use the Single rider line if its not crowded. For fastlane its $15.00 and you get to skip the line for 4 rides. It works on Scream, Goliath, Riddlers, Collosus, Viper, Revelution and Log Jammer. Kevin"Have Fun!"Bujold
